Built to Read From the Road, Survive the Weather
Outdoor signage carries the heaviest structural and regulatory demands — wind load, mounting depth, illumination wiring, and in some cases county approval. Each product line below is engineered around those constraints from the first sketch.

3D Signs
Sculpted, built-out lettering and logos that give a storefront or fascia genuine depth instead of a flat printed panel. We fabricate in aluminum, dimensional acrylic, and foam-core composite, then finish with automotive-grade paint or cast vinyl so color holds under direct sun. Faces can be flat-cut, halo-lit, or face-lit depending on how the sign needs to read at night.

2D Signs
Flat-panel signage for budget-conscious projects that still need crisp, professional print quality — composite panel or Dibond substrates with UV-cured ink or laminated vinyl overlays. A cost-effective route to consistent branding across multiple locations without sacrificing legibility.

Pylon Signs
Freestanding, elevated signage for petrol stations, malls, and multi-tenant developments where visibility from a distance and from moving traffic matters most. We engineer the steel support structure to the site’s soil and wind conditions, then mount illuminated or static faces at the height your visibility study calls for.

Illuminated LED Signs
Low-draw LED modules built into channel letters, box signs, and pylon faces so your signage keeps working after dark — arguably when it matters most for storefronts and hospitality venues. We spec waterproof drivers and sealed wiring runs for outdoor installs, and can program RGB faces for color-changing brand moments.

Monument Signs
Low, ground-anchored signage that doubles as a landscaping feature — common at estate entrances, corporate campuses, and institutional grounds. Built on a masonry or composite base with dimensional lettering set into the face, monument signs read as permanent architecture rather than temporary marketing.

Channel Letter Fabrication
Individually formed letters with returns, trim caps, and internal LED illumination — the standard for corporate fascia and mall storefront signage. Each letter is built to exact font geometry from your brand guidelines, so kerning and proportion match your logo precisely instead of approximating it.

Custom Installations
Non-standard mounting scenarios — curved facades, heritage buildings, high-rise fascia, or awkward structural access — handled by our own install crew rather than subcontracted out. We carry out the same field survey and load assessment on install day that shaped the original fabrication drawing.

Construction Signs
Site hoarding graphics, safety signage, and project boards that meet contractor and municipal requirements while still carrying your brand and development messaging. Weather-sealed for the duration of a build, with quick-turnaround reprints when phases or contact details change.

Traffic Road Signs
Reflective, regulation-spec traffic and road signage for municipalities, estates, and private roads — engineer-grade reflective sheeting on aluminum blanks so signs remain legible in headlight beams at night. Produced to standard shapes and colors for regulatory sign categories, or custom for estate wayfinding.

Banners
Large-format PVC and mesh banners for launches, seasonal promotions, and events — printed in-house so short lead times don’t compromise color accuracy. Mesh options are wind-permeable for rooftop and fence-line mounting where solid banners would tear.
Turn Every Trip Into an Impression
A wrapped vehicle earns thousands of visual impressions a day just sitting in traffic — more cost-effective per impression than almost any other outdoor medium. We design the layout around the vehicle’s actual panel lines and curves, not a flat template stretched over a photo.
Full wraps, partial wraps, and cut-vinyl lettering are all produced on cast vinyl film rated for multi-year exterior exposure, then installed by trained applicators who heat-form the material around mirrors, door handles, and body creases so nothing lifts or bubbles.

Finished for Close-Up Viewing, Every Day
Indoor signage lives at arm’s length from staff and visitors, so tolerances tighten — clean edges, matched paint, and mounting hardware that won’t mark a wall. These are the product lines that carry a brand from the parking lot into the building itself.

Door Signs
Office and room identification plates in brushed metal, acrylic, or engraved laminate — with braille and ADA-compliant options for accessible buildings.

Reception Signs
The first branded surface a visitor sees — dimensional logo letters mounted on feature walls, often paired with backlighting for a premium first impression.

Neon Signs
LED-neon (flex-neon) signage for retail interiors, cafes, and studios — the classic glow-tube look without the fragility or power draw of true glass neon.

Large Format Printing
Wall graphics, window film, exhibition panels, and point-of-sale displays printed at production scale for showrooms, trade stands, and offices.

Name Tags & Plates
Engraved desk plates, staff name badges, and building directories — precision-cut and finished to match your corporate identity down to the typeface.

Laser Cut & Engraving
Precision laser-cut logos, awards, and dimensional detailing in acrylic, wood, and metal — used across both indoor signage and standalone branded pieces.
From Site Survey to Signed-Off Installation
Site Survey
We measure the actual structure, mounting surface, and viewing distance before any design work starts.
Design & Proof
Logo creation or brand-matched layout, delivered as a visual proof for sign-off before fabrication.
Fabrication
Cutting, welding, printing, and finishing carried out on our own workshop floor for quality control.
Installation
Our own install crew mounts and wires the finished sign, matching the original survey specifications.
Aftercare
Maintenance, relamping, and repair support for illuminated and outdoor signage after handover.
